Bug description:
  Binary package hint: gnome-do-plugins

  I select a text in a document and I try to install that package with Install plugin of gnome-do but it fails:
  "Error showing url: Error stating file '/usr/bin/apturl apt:libpcsclite-dev': No such file or directory"

  Bit if I execute, in console, "/usr/bin/apturl apt:libpcsclite-dev",
  it works.
